What is a 2020 F250 Wiring Diagram and How is it Used?
A 2020 F250 wiring diagram is essentially a roadmap for your truck's electrical system. It visually represents all the wires, connectors, components, and their interconnections. Think of it like the blueprints for your house's electrical wiring; it shows where every wire goes, what it powers, and how it's controlled. Without this diagram, diagnosing electrical issues would be a guessing game, leading to wasted time and potentially more damage.
These diagrams are crucial for a variety of tasks. For mechanics, they are indispensable for troubleshooting everything from faulty headlights to engine performance issues. For DIY enthusiasts, they allow for safe and accurate installation of aftermarket accessories like auxiliary lighting, winches, or trailer brake controllers. Here are some common uses:
- Diagnosing and repairing circuits that are not functioning.
- Installing new electrical accessories or components.
- Understanding the function of specific switches and sensors.
- Tracing power and ground connections.
